F-Gas Certification UK: City & Guilds 2079 and ACS Assessment Guide

F-Gas certification is a legal requirement for UK engineers who install, service or decommission refrigeration, AC and heat pump systems containing fluorinated greenhouse gases. This guide explains the main qualification routes and what they cover.

What the Course Covers

Refrigerant safety and properties, F-Gas legislation, leak checking schedules, refrigerant recovery and recycling, charging procedures, cylinder handling, PPE requirements, record keeping obligations.

Finding an Approved Assessment Centre

Search the City & Guilds website or REFCOM training centre directory for UKAS-accredited centres near you. Assessment centres include CITB-approved colleges and FETA-member training bodies.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need Category I or II F-Gas certification?

Category I for most HVAC work including A2L refrigerants (R32, R1234yf) and larger systems. Category II limited to A1 non-flammable gases and smaller charges. When in doubt, get Category I.

How long does City & Guilds 2079 take?

Typically 3–5 days at an approved centre. Intensive 2–3 day courses available for experienced engineers.

Is City & Guilds 2079 valid across the UK?

Yes — recognised throughout England, Scotland, Wales and Northern Ireland by refrigerant suppliers and the Environment Agency.
